Abstract

Official abstract text for this publication.

A staple cartridge assembly for use with a surgical stapling instrument includes a staple cartridge including a plurality of staples and a cartridge deck. The staple cartridge assembly also includes a compressible adjunct positionable against the cartridge deck, wherein the staples are deployable into tissue captured against the compressible adjunct, and wherein the compressible adjunct comprises a first biocompatible layer comprising a first portion, a second biocompatible layer comprising a second portion, and crossed spacer fibers extending between the first portion and the second portion.

First claim

Opening claim text (preview).

What is claimed is: 1. A staple cartridge assembly for use with a surgical stapling instrument, wherein the staple cartridge assembly comprises: a staple cartridge, comprising: a plurality of staples; and a cartridge deck; and a collapsible absorbable lattice positionable against the cartridge deck, wherein the staples are deployable into tissue captured against the collapsible absorbable lattice, and wherein the collapsible absorbable lattice comprises: a first biocompatible layer; a second biocompatible layer; and standing fibers interconnecting the first biocompatible layer and the second biocompatible layer, wherein the standing fibers cooperatively maintain the first biocompatible layer away from the second biocompatible layer, and wherein the standing fibers comprise end portions embedded into the second biocompatible layer. 2.
